Australian Government and Online Gambling Laws

The Interactive Gambling Act 2001 forms the cornerstone of Australia’s online gambling regulation. This legislation prohibits Australian-based companies from offering most real-money online casino games to Australian residents.

As of 2025, the regulatory landscape focuses heavily on sports betting platforms rather than casino-style games. When dynamic odds systems are implemented, they must comply with Australian consumer laws regarding transparency and fairness.

You should be aware that Australian law doesn’t provide specific protections for players using offshore casino sites with dynamic odds adjustments. The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) actively enforces blocking measures against unlicensed offshore gambling operators.

Recent amendments have strengthened penalties for operators who circumvent these regulations, with fines reaching into the millions for serious violations.

Consumer Protection and Responsible Gaming Measures

Australian gambling operators must implement robust responsible gambling measures. This includes providing clear information about how dynamic odds adjustments work in real-time.

You’ll notice mandatory features across Australian gambling platforms:

  • Pre-commitment tools: Set spending and time limits before playing
  • Self-exclusion programs: Block yourself from gambling for set periods
  • Activity statements: Review your gambling patterns and expenditure
  • Reality checks: Receive notifications about time spent gambling

The Australian Gambling Research Centre conducts ongoing studies into the psychological effects of dynamic odds systems. Their findings inform public health approaches to gambling harm minimisation.

State-based regulatory bodies like Liquor & Gaming NSW and the Victorian Commission for Gambling and Liquor Regulation enforce strict standards for operators using AI-driven odds adjustments.

Traditional vs E-Wallets and Cryptocurrency

Traditional payment methods like credit cards and bank transfers have been the backbone of online wagering in Australia for years. These methods typically offer familiarity but often involve longer processing times, particularly for withdrawals which can take 3-5 business days.

E-wallets like PayPal, Neteller and Skrill have gained significant popularity by offering faster transaction speeds and an additional layer of security. Your financial details remain protected as you don’t share them directly with gambling operators.

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ies represent the newest frontier in wagering payments. These options provide enhanced anonymity and typically feature lower transaction fees compared to traditional methods. Many online casinos now accept cryptocurrency, though sports betting platforms in Australia have been slower to adopt these payment solutions.

The shift toward digital payment methods has coincided with increased gambling accessibility and potentially higher spending patterns, as digital transactions create psychological distance from the concept of spending real money.
